CARICOM leaders can enhance trade by promoting regional integration through the reduction of tariffs and non-tariff barriers, facilitating easier movement of goods and services among member states. They may also invest in infrastructure improvements to streamline logistics and transportation networks. Additionally, establishing trade agreements with external partners can open new markets for CARICOM countries, while fostering collaboration on shared resources and industries can strengthen intra-regional trade ties. Finally, leveraging technology and digital platforms to enhance e-commerce can further boost trade opportunities within the region.
